I have not > looked into this. > Jesse > > On Sun, Jun 5, 2011 at 7:53 AM, Matthew Hiles<matthew.hi...@gmail.com> wrote: >> Hello, >> >> I'm trying to make uniarch packages for archlinux. Since I'm using >> arch's abs build framework, I can't quite follow the build instructions >> from >> http://sourceforge.net/apps/mediawiki/mspgcc/index.php?title=Devel:UniarchGit >> to the tee. I'm following as closely as I can while taking what I can >> get from the old mspgcc4 packages that someone else made for arch. >> >> So far, I've got binutils compiled, but I'm stuck trying to compile gcc >> itself. >> >> >> The error I get is >> >> >> gcc -O2 -pipe -DIN_GCC -DCROSS_DIRECTORY_STRUCTURE -W -Wall >> -Wwrite-strings -Wcast-qual -Wstrict-prototypes -Wmissing-prototypes >> -Wmissing-format-attribute -pedantic -Wno-long-long -Wno-variadic-macros >> -Wno-overlength-strings -Wold-style-definition -Wc++-compat >> -DHAVE_CONFIG_H -Wl,--hash-style=gnu -Wl,--as-needed -o cc1-dummy >> c-lang.o stub-objc.o attribs.o c-errors.o c-lex.o c-pragma.o c-decl.o >> c-typeck.o c-convert.o c-aux-info.o c-common.o c-opts.o c-format.o >> c-semantics.o c-ppoutput.o c-cppbuiltin.o c-objc-common.o c-dump.o >> c-pch.o c-parser.o c-gimplify.o tree-mudflap.o c-pretty-print.o c-omp.o \ >> dummy-checksum.o main.o libbackend.a ../libcpp/libcpp.a >> ../libdecnumber/libdecnumber.a ../libcpp/libcpp.a >> ../libiberty/libiberty.a ../libdecnumber/libdecnumber.a >> -L/tmp/mspgcc-mspgcc/src/build/./gmp/.libs >> -L/tmp/mspgcc-mspgcc/src/build/./mpfr/.libs -lmpc -lmpfr -lgmp -rdynamic >> -ldl -L../zlib -lz -lelf >> /usr/bin/ld: __gmpfr_cache_const_euler: TLS definition in >> /usr/lib/libmpfr.so.4 section .tdata mismatches non-TLS definition in >> /tmp/mspgcc-mspgcc/src/build/./mpfr/.libs/libmpfr.a(const_euler.o) >> section .data >> /usr/lib/libmpfr.so.4: could not read symbols: Bad value >> >> >> I'm using the following versions: >> >> _gcc_version=4.5.1 >> _gmp_version=4.3.2 >> _mpfr_version=2.4.2 >> >> and gcc is configured with >> >> ../gcc-${_gcc_version}/configure \ >> --disable-libssp \ >> --disable-nls \ >> --target=msp430 \ >> --enable-languages=c,c++ \ >> --infodir=/usr/share/info \ >> --libdir=/usr/lib \ >> --libexecdir=/usr/lib \ >> --mandir=/usr/share/man \ >> --prefix=/usr \ >> --with-gnu-as \ >> --with-gnu-ld \ >> --with-as=/usr/bin/msp430-as \ >> --with-ld=/usr/bin/msp430-ld \ >> --with-pkgversion="MSPGCC-GIT-UNIARCH" >> >> It seems like I'm missing a library, have a version mismatch, or have >> mis-configured something.
